GENE CLUSTER FOR BIOSYNTHESIS OF CYCLOCLAVINE
申请人:Schroeder Hartwig
公开号:US20140073008A1
公开(公告)日:2014-03-13
The invention in principle pertains to the field of recombinant manufacture of alkaloids and, in particular, cycloclavine. It provides polynucleotides for the gene cluster of enzymes involved in the biosynthesis of cycloclavin as well as vectors and host cells comprising such polynucleotides. Also provided are polypeptides encoded by the said polynucleotides which can be applied in a method for the manufacture of cycloclavine also encompassed by the present invention.
PROSS OPTIMIZED ENZYMES
申请人:IGC BIO, INC.
公开号:US20200291366A1
公开(公告)日:2020-09-17
The present invention provides enzymes that have been optimized by implementation of Protein Repair One Stop Shop (PROSS), an algorithm that generates protein design(s) for enhanced stability without changing either enzymatic properties or enzyme active site conformation of the respective enzyme. The protein design(s) generated by PROSS introduce mutations to the amino acid sequence of a wild-type protein, resulting in a mutated amino acid sequence that encodes a variant of the wild-type enzyme, i.e., “an enzyme variant”, which has an enhanced stability, core packing, surface polarity and backbone rigidity, a higher functional expression, and/or a combination thereof, compared to the stability core packing, surface polarity and backbone rigidity, functional expression and/or a combination thereof, of the wild-type enzyme.
